Recently, I took a (short) break from university coursework in order to chat up my guildies as well as see what’s up in PVP.

One of the things I noticed was that a lot of people seem to be really vexed about running into teams with a lot of “Meta” classes. Some people had apparently been getting enemy teams with at least three reapers for the past five matches, or they’ve been getting a bunch of druids, or tempest ele’s, or what-not.

Personally I am of the opinion that PvP is basically #ThugLife and that solo queue is kind of like Russian Roulette, but they did get me thinking.

Recently we’ve seen the advent of maps that are not Conquest-based. This gave me the idea of a third possible queue option.

My idea is simple: Normal conquest with the normal conquest maps, but with a restriction that only allows one of each class per team. This would even the teams out a little bit more, and might go some way to alleviate any balance issues that have not been addressed yet.

Would such a modified conquest mode be feasible for implementation? What would we even name it?

Balance among the classes is one thing, balance among teams is another. If you’ve fixed a class balance issue, there is still a balance issue when 3 or more of the same class, (let’s say 4-5 tempests) team up.

So, definitely, I would like to see the queues restricting parties with 3 or more of the same class. How that would affect the queue times, I can’t say. Matches are made with what’s available at a given time.
